Wellbeing Walk: Philips Park

Key Details
Date: Wednesday 12th November
Time: Meet at 12:00pm
Meeting Point: Etihad Campus Tram Stop (Metrolink) – we’ll meet outside the stop before walking over together to Philips Park.

Join us for a gentle and social wellbeing walk around Philips Park, one of Manchester’s oldest public parks and a beautiful green escape right in the city.

This is a great opportunity to get outdoors, connect with others, and enjoy some fresh air and movement at your own pace.
From the Etihad Campus tram stop, it’s roughly a 10-minute walk (0.5 miles) to the park entrance on Stuart Street.

We’ll take a relaxed route through the park’s woodland paths and open green spaces, with time for a chat and a hot drink afterwards if you’d like to stay.

Accessibility information:
· The route from the tram stop to the park is step-free and mostly paved.
· Inside the park, paths are a mix of paved and gravel surfaces; some areas may be uneven or muddy depending on the weather.
· The main walking route will be kept as flat and accessible as possible.
· Toilets are available near the main park entrance.
· The Etihad Campus tram stop has step-free access and frequent trams from Manchester city centre.
